Key Facts
- Pennsylvania state income tax on $10,465,000 is $321,276 — 3.07% of gross income.
- Combined with federal taxes and FICA, total tax burden is $4,399,841 (42.04%).
- Take-home pay is $6,065,159, or $505,430 per month.
- Philadelphia residents pay additional 3.75% wage tax
